The Benefits of Free Stopovers

Traveling can be exhausting, especially when you have long-haul flights. Here are some compelling reasons to consider airlines that offer free stopovers:

  • Explore New Destinations: You get to experience a new city without the added expense of a separate flight.
  • Break Up Long Flights: Long flights can be tiring. A stopover allows you to stretch your legs and refresh before continuing your journey.
  • Cultural Experiences: Spend a day or two immersing yourself in a different culture, trying local cuisine, and visiting landmarks.
  • Cost-Effective Travel: Often, flights with stopovers can be cheaper than direct flights, allowing you to save money while exploring.

Top Airlines Offering Free Stopovers

1. Icelandair

Icelandair is well-known for its generous stopover policy. Passengers flying between North America and Europe can enjoy a stopover in Reykjavik for up to seven days at no additional airfare. This is a fantastic way to explore Iceland’s stunning landscapes, hot springs, and vibrant culture.

2. Emirates

Emirates offers a free stopover in Dubai for travelers flying to various destinations across Asia, Africa, and Australia. With luxurious hotels and a plethora of attractions, including the Burj Khalifa and Dubai Mall, a stopover in Dubai can be an unforgettable experience.

3. Qatar Airways

Qatar Airways allows travelers to enjoy a stopover in Doha for up to four days. With its modern architecture, rich history, and cultural experiences, Doha is an excellent choice for a brief getaway. Plus, Qatar Airways often provides complimentary hotel stays for passengers with long layovers.

4. Turkish Airlines

Turkish Airlines offers free stopovers in Istanbul for travelers flying to various destinations. This is an excellent opportunity to explore the rich history and culture of Istanbul, from the Hagia Sophia to the Grand Bazaar. The airline also provides hotel accommodations for eligible passengers.

5. Singapore Airlines

Singapore Airlines allows travelers to enjoy a stopover in Singapore for up to two nights. With its beautiful gardens, diverse culinary scene, and vibrant neighborhoods, Singapore is a fantastic destination to explore during your travels.
